Description

Gossipgate Bridge, located to the south-west of Gossipgate House, is a bridge that likely dates from the 18th century. It is constructed from coursed, squared rubble and features flat copings on its parapet. The bridge has a single segmental arch, and there is a dated inscription on a panel above the center on the west side that reads: "REPAIRED BY SUBSCRIPTION 1834."
